AgCl(s) ---> Ag^+(aq) + Cl^-(aq)
DG0rxn = (DG0f,Ag+ + DG0f,Cl^-) - (DG0f,AgCl)
= (77.1 + (-131.2)) - (-109.8)
= 55.7 kj/mol
DG0 = - RTlnKsp
55.7*10^3 = -8.314*298lnKsp
Ksp of AgCl = 1.723*10^-10
AgBr(s) ---> Ag^+(aq) + Br^-(aq)
DG0rxn = (DG0f,Ag+ + DG0f,Br^-) - (DG0f,AgBr)
= (77.1 + (-104.0)) - (-96.9)
= 70 kj/mol
DG0 = - RTlnKsp
70*10^3 = -8.314*298lnKsp
Ksp of AgBr = 5.36*10^-13
